Inclusion criteria

Inclusion criteria: (1) Meet the diagnostic criteria of the Chinese Classification of Cerebrovascular Diseases 2015 and confirmed by CT or MRI; (2) the first onset, the duration of stroke <=1 month <=6 months; (3) Over 18 years old; (4) The Brunnstrom stage of the affected limb was I.~V. stage; (5) The patient or his/her family members sign the relevant informed consent form.

Exclusion criteria

Exclusion criteria: (1) Motor dysfunction caused by other neurological diseases, such as Parkinson's disease, Alzheimer's disease, motor neuron disease, head injury, cerebellar or brainstem stroke; (2) Severe speech and cognitive impairment; (3) Those whose vital signs are unstable or in the acute stage of the disease; (4) Pregnant persons, enshrined hearts, and people who are restrained.
